How to Fill Down in Microsoft Excel

Quick summary

The Fill Down feature in Microsoft Excel lets you copy a formula from one cell to an entire column in seconds. Using the fill handle — the small square at the bottom-right of a selected cell — you can double-click to instantly propagate formulas without manual entry.


Steps

  1. Click on the cell containing the formula you want to copy — the fill handle is the small square at the bottom-right corner of the selected cell.
  2. Double-click the fill handle to copy the formula down, aligning with the range of adjacent columns.
  3. Scroll down to confirm the formula has been copied correctly to all rows in the column.
